dc.description.abstractThe paper deals with the relevant problem: ensuring safety and sustainability of urban transport systems. Authors have considered existing positive world wide experience of both infrastructure and managerial solutions. Using the city of Naberezhnye Chelny as an example, a method is proposed for improving the safety of transport systems by improving cycle structures. To reach this, authors have conducted a study of the prospects for the development of bicycle transport in the city by caring out a survey of the population. On the basis of the conducted research, the effectiveness of the proposed solution for the development of bicycle transport was revealed. To implement this solution, the authors of the article have developed DSS for assessing the effectiveness and safety of infrastructure projects. Case study of Naberezhnye Chelny is an example of the implementation and the possibility of using the proposed DSS; however, this intelligent system is universal and can be applied to any city.en_US
